Job Title: Chemical Engineer – Bioprocess & Process Development Location: Bengaluru, India Employment Type: Full-time Role Overview We are establishing a dedicated Process Development capability within our biotechnology R&D facility to support the development and industrialisation of renewable and sustainable natural aroma ingredients for the flavour and fragrance industry. We seek a

Chemical Engineer with strong hands-on experience in bioprocess design, fermentation, biocatalysis, and downstream processing, capable of bridging experimental R&D with industrial process, equipment, and utility design at pilot and production scale. This position operates at the interface between R&D and Manufacturing and will play a key role in: Translating laboratory processes into scalable, robust, and economically viable manufacturing processes Leading scale-up, technology transfer, and process optimisation activities Contributing to the establishment of a Process Development group responsible for scale-up strategy, process design, and plant interface

Key Responsibilities Bioprocess & Fermentation Development Design, execute, and optimise fermentation and biocatalytic processes for aroma ingredient production Develop scalable bioprocess flowsheets from laboratory to pilot and manufacturing scale Define and optimise media composition, feeding strategies, pH, temperature, aeration, agitation, and operating modes (batch, fed-batch, continuous where appropriate) Perform mass and energy balances for upstream and downstream operations Define scale-up criteria related to mixing, oxygen transfer, heat removal, shear, and residence time Downstream Processing &; Product Recovery Develop and optimise recovery and purification strategies including liquid–liquid extraction, phase separation, distillation, adsorption, and chromatography Translate laboratory purification schemes into industrially viable operations

Evaluate solvent selection, solvent recovery, waste streams, and environmental impact Process Design & Equipment Interface Define preliminary equipment sizing and utility requirements for pilot and production scale Translate experimental data into process design inputs for internal and external engineering teams Support selection of reactors, fermenters, separators, heat exchangers, and auxiliary equipment Contribute to layout concepts and plant integration discussions Scale-Up, Technology Transfer & Plant Support Plan and execute scale-up and pilot trials in collaboration with R&D and manufacturing Prepare and implement technology transfer packages from R&D to production Develop SOPs, batch records, process descriptions, and scale-up reports Support troubleshooting of process deviations at pilot and plant scale Drive continuous improvement, debottlenecking, and yield optimisation initiatives Process Economics & Feasibility Provide technical inputs for costing, feasibility studies, and business cases Build and maintain CAPEX and OPEX models for new product processes Identify opportunities for cost reduction, yield improvement, and energy optimisation Cross-Functional Collaboration Work closely with microbiologists, chemists, analytical teams, and manufacturing Interface with external engineering and equipment suppliers as required Contribute to internal best practices for process development and scale-up

Required Qualifications M.Tech or PhD in Chemical Engineering 3–8 years of relevant experience in bioprocessing, fermentation, biocatalysis, or process development Hands-on experience with bioreactors/fermenters at laboratory, pilot, and preferably industrial scale Strong understanding of reaction engineering, transport phenomena, thermodynamics, and separation processes

Demonstrated experience translating laboratory processes to pilot or plant scale Experience developing CAPEX/OPEX models and techno-economic assessments

Experience Required Exposure to aroma, flavour, fragrance, fine chemicals, or specialty chemicals Experience with process simulation and modelling tools (Aspen Plus, Matlab or equivalent) Familiarity with Design of Experiments (DoE) and data-driven optimisation Experience operating in cross-functional R&D–Manufacturing environments
